1970 Mercedes Benz 280SL, Driving project car, convertible with hard top. It has an auto trans and IS NOT equipped with AC. 
The good: Engine runs well, starts right up, with no weird engine noises such as valve clatter, worn rod or main bearings, no oil smoke from exhaust. Engine idles well and cool, does not run hot or overheats. The transmission shifts well with no slipping. The engine, radiator, transmission, power steering do not leak oil. The differential is quiet with no pinion or bearing whine when driving. The differential is moist on the bottom, it doesn't leak oil onto the floor but has some moistness that has accumulated. The brakes do not leak and the car has a good firm pedal with good braking power. Exhaust has been replaced with a stainless steel exhaust system. All the gauges work.The chrome trim is in decent shape as well. It is a to owner car and comes with the original dealer invoice and some other documentation as well. There is no rot on the lower edges of the doors, or at the front and rear shock towers. 
The so so: The body and interior are fair, there are no signs the car was ever in an accident. The car has dings and touch ups mainly to the right door and right rear quarter panel (see photos). The paint has flaked off at various spots on the body and a couple of these have some surface rust ( I photographed each one). The trunk floor has some surface rust, there are no holes going through the trunk floor. The interior is fair as well, it's not horrid however it's not going to win any shows either. 
The bad: This car needs floors, the floor sections on both sides are pretty much gone (see photos). The inner rocker panel on the driver side toward the rear wheel well looks pretty bad. It is hard to tell exactly where the rockers are good, where they are bad, however just assume that both right and left rockers should be replaced as do the entire floor sections.This is not a job to do in your back yard unless you have experience and tools to tackle this. I would also like to add that the estimate on labor I received to repair the floors and rockers was 50 hours plus the cost of the panels. The sheet metal is available from various MB suppliers like K&K manufacturing and  even the MB dealer.

Carlsson turns Mercedes-Benz SLK into 610-HP hill-climb clawer

Mon, 28 Jan 2013

Carlsson's race-tuned versions of the Mercedes-Benz SLK have been taking checkered flags for years, and we won't be surprised if its SLK 340 hill climber fares any different. Developed by multiple German and Swiss hill climb champion Reto Meisel, the carbon-bodied SLK 340 with lightweight brakes and a closed underbody weighs 1,716 pounds. Propelling that tiny bit of weight is a 3.4-liter V8 from Judd with 610 horsepower, and it rolls on 18-inch wheels shod in Avon tires.
It will debut at the Geneva Motor Show before beginning its racing campaigns in the summer. This one won't just tear up roads in Europe, though - Meisel says he plans on bringing it to the Pikes Peak International Hill Climb. The press release below has more details.

2013 Mercedes-Benz GLK250 Bluetec gets 33 mpg, priced from $38,950*

Tue, 30 Apr 2013

It's been more than a year since we first saw the 2013 Mercedes-Benz GLK250 Bluetec unveiled at the 2012 New York Auto Show, but it looks like the compact diesel crossover is finally starting to roll into dealerships. Those wanting to buy a diesel GLK will only have to pony up an extra $1,500 over a base, gas-powered GLK350, as the GLK250's starting price is listed at $38,590 (*not including $905 destination charge).
The turbocharged 2.1-liter four-cylinder diesel produces 200 horsepower and 369 pound-feet of torque, and Mercedes-Benz has also provided some fuel economy numbers for this model, with claimed EPA estimates of 24 miles per gallon city and 33 mpg highway. There is no listing for the GLK250 on the EPA's website yet, but the figures represent significant increase over the GLK350's lackluster 19 mpg city and 25 mpg highway figures, which are for the rear-wheel drive model. The GLK250 comes standard with the 4Matic all-wheel-drive system - a $2,000 option on GLK350 - meaning that if you want an all-wheel-drive version of the 2013 GLK, it's actually cheaper to opt for the diesel model.
